The Assembly Supervisor is responsible for overseeing all activities within the assembly line to ensure efficient production, adherence to quality standards, and timely delivery of products. This role involves managing a team of assembly operators, coordinating with other departments, and ensuring compliance with company policies, safety standards, and production targets.
Key Responsibilities
1. Production Supervision
Plan, organize, and monitor daily assembly operations to meet production schedules and targets.
Allocate manpower, materials, and equipment effectively.
Ensure optimal line balance and minimize downtime.
2. Quality Assurance
Ensure that all assembly work meets company quality standards and specifications.
Identify and address defects or process issues promptly.
Work closely with the Quality Department to implement corrective and preventive actions.
3. Team Management
Supervise, train, and motivate assembly operators to achieve departmental goals.
Conduct daily team briefings and communicate production plans and safety instructions.
Monitor attendance, performance, and discipline of team members.
4. Process Improvement
Implement lean manufacturing principles and continuous improvement initiatives.
Identify areas for productivity enhancement and waste reduction.
Support process optimization and equipment maintenance activities.
5. Safety & Compliance
Ensure compliance with workplace safety regulations and company policies.
Conduct routine safety checks and promote a culture of safety among the team.
6. Reporting & Coordination
Maintain daily production and performance records.
Report deviations, delays, or issues to the Production Manager.
Coordinate with Planning, Quality, and Maintenance teams for smooth workflow.
